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II

Submitted by Automa??o e Estat?stica (sst@bczm.ufrn.br) on 2017-03-14T21:32:46Z No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) === Approved for entry into archive by Arlan Eloi Leite Silva (eloihistoriador@yahoo.com.br) on 20...

Full description

Bibliographic Details
Main Author: Santos, Davi Henrique dos
Other Authors: 32541457120
Language:Portuguese
Published: PROGRAMA DE P?S-GRADUA??O EM ENGENHARIA EL?TRICA E DE COMPUTA??O 2017
Subjects:
Online Access:https://repositorio.ufrn.br/jspui/handle/123456789/22257
id ndltd-IBICT-oai-repositorio.ufrn.br-123456789-22257
record_format oai_dc
collection NDLTD
language Portuguese
sources NDLTD
topic CNPQ::ENGENHARIAS::ENGENHARIA ELETRICA E DE COMPUTA??O
Veleiros aut?nomos
Controladores PI
Planejamento de caminhos
Otimiza??o de caminhos
Algoritmos gen?ticos
spellingShingle CNPQ::ENGENHARIAS::ENGENHARIA ELETRICA E DE COMPUTA??O
Veleiros aut?nomos
Controladores PI
Planejamento de caminhos
Otimiza??o de caminhos
Algoritmos gen?ticos
Santos, Davi Henrique dos
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II
description Submitted by Automa??o e Estat?stica (sst@bczm.ufrn.br) on 2017-03-14T21:32:46Z No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) === Approved for entry into archive by Arlan Eloi Leite Silva (eloihistoriador@yahoo.com.br) on 2017-03-15T22:17:57Z (GMT) No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) === Made available in DSpace on 2017-03-15T22:17:57Z (GMT). No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) Previous issue date: 2016-07-13 === Coordena??o de Aperfei?oamento de Pessoal de N?vel Superior (CAPES) === As pesquisas relacionadas ? automa??o de veleiros rob?ticos cresceram rapidamente nos ?ltimos 15 anos. Os principais desafios enfrentados nos projetos de veleiros aut?nomos s?o o controle, planejamento de caminho e trajet?ria, coleta de dados dos sensores e o suprimento energ?tico. Desta forma, o presente trabalho realiza um estudo sobre problemas de controle e planejamento de caminho comumente encontrados durante o projeto de veleiros aut?nomos. Os m?todos aqui desenvolvidos ser?o aplicados nos veleiros utilizados no projeto N-Boat, permitindo aos mesmos alcan?ar os pontos alvos, realizando a dif?cil tarefa de velejar contra o vento caso necess?rio. Para alcan?ar estes objetivos, primeiramente um m?todo para encontrar o controlador de baixo n?vel mais adequado ? aplica??o desejada foi desenvolvido. O m?todo utiliza um controlador PI com par?metros vari?veis, encontrando uma tabela que cont?m os melhores par?metros proporcional e integrativo adequados a cada situa??o, de acordo com o modelo utilizado. Um m?todo para a gera??o de caminho em situa??es de contravento foi modelado, implementado e testado em simula??o. Para gerar os pontos do caminho, o m?todo utiliza dois par?metros: a dist?ncia dispon?vel e a orienta??o desejada para o veleiro durante a manobra. Em seguida, um m?todo de otimiza??o foi implementado e testado em simula??o. O m?todo utiliza algoritmos gen?ticos para manipular os par?metros do m?todo de gera??o de caminhos, encontrando quais par?metros geram o trajeto de menor tempo ao destino. O trabalho apresenta diversos testes em simula??o para demonstrar a validade e robustez dos m?todos desenvolvidos. === The main challenges in the development of autonomous sailboats are: control, path and trajectory planning, sensor data acquitision, and power supply. Towards this direction, this paper introduces a study on the problems of control and path planning commonly found during the autonomous sailing projects. The methods developed here are to be applied in the sailboats used in the N-Boat project, allowing them to reach targets points accurately and quickly, and to perform one of the must difficult tasks in sailing that is navigating against the wind. To achieve these goals, at first, a method to find the most appropriate low level controller for the desired application is developed. This method uses a dynamic PI controller, coming up with a table that contains the best proportional and integrative parameters that are appropriate to each situation according to the model used. A method for generation of paths in situations contrary to wind is also modeled, implemented and tested (in simulation). To generate the way points, this method takes into account two parameters: the distance available for the maneuvering and the desired orientation of the boat during the maneuver. An optimization method is proposed, based on genethic algorithm, implemented, and also tested (in simulation) for getting the controller best parameters. The method manipulate some defined parameters for generating paths, finding the ones that generate the path in which the boat achieves the minimum time to destination. Results of various simulation experiments are shown to demonstrate the validity and robustness of the methods developed.
author2 32541457120
author_facet 32541457120
Santos, Davi Henrique dos
author Santos, Davi Henrique dos
author_sort Santos, Davi Henrique dos
title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II
title_short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II
title_full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II
title_fullStr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II
title_full_unstemmed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II
title_sort contro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ico nboat ii
publisher PROGRAMA DE P?S-GRADUA??O EM ENGENHARIA EL?TRICA E DE COMPUTA??O
publishDate 2017
url https://repositorio.ufrn.br/jspui/handle/123456789/22257
work_keys_str_mv AT santosdavihenriquedos controledeorientaoeplanejamentodecaminhodecurtadistnciaparaoveleirorobticonboatii
_version_ 1718672674592391168
spelling ndltd-IBICT-oai-repositorio.ufrn.br-123456789-222572018-05-23T23:29:05Z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II Santos, Davi Henrique dos 32541457120 Burlamaqui, Aquiles Medeiros Filgueira 03420818459 http://lattes.cnpq.br/8670475877813913 Silva, Jo?o Moreno Vilas Boas de Souza 00958725403 http://lattes.cnpq.br/8722766030280997 Aroca, Rafael Vidal 28068503803 http://lattes.cnpq.br/9262228584082064 Gon?alves, Luiz Marcos Garcia CNPQ::ENGENHARIAS::ENGENHARIA ELETRICA E DE COMPUTA??O Veleiros aut?nomos Controladores PI Planejamento de caminhos Otimiza??o de caminhos Algoritmos gen?ticos Submitted by Automa??o e Estat?stica (sst@bczm.ufrn.br) on 2017-03-14T21:32:46Z No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) Approved for entry into archive by Arlan Eloi Leite Silva (eloihistoriador@yahoo.com.br) on 2017-03-15T22:17:57Z (GMT) No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) Made available in DSpace on 2017-03-15T22:17:57Z (GMT). No. of bitstreams: 1 DaviHenriqueDosSantos_DISSERT.pdf: 3943405 bytes, checksum: 5c8c6264a12d6d09afccf8adb3614371 (MD5) Previous issue date: 2016-07-13 Coordena??o de Aperfei?oamento de Pessoal de N?vel Superior (CAPES) As pesquisas relacionadas ? automa??o de veleiros rob?ticos cresceram rapidamente nos ?ltimos 15 anos. Os principais desafios enfrentados nos projetos de veleiros aut?nomos s?o o controle, planejamento de caminho e trajet?ria, coleta de dados dos sensores e o suprimento energ?tico. Desta forma, o presente trabalho realiza um estudo sobre problemas de controle e planejamento de caminho comumente encontrados durante o projeto de veleiros aut?nomos. Os m?todos aqui desenvolvidos ser?o aplicados nos veleiros utilizados no projeto N-Boat, permitindo aos mesmos alcan?ar os pontos alvos, realizando a dif?cil tarefa de velejar contra o vento caso necess?rio. Para alcan?ar estes objetivos, primeiramente um m?todo para encontrar o controlador de baixo n?vel mais adequado ? aplica??o desejada foi desenvolvido. O m?todo utiliza um controlador PI com par?metros vari?veis, encontrando uma tabela que cont?m os melhores par?metros proporcional e integrativo adequados a cada situa??o, de acordo com o modelo utilizado. Um m?todo para a gera??o de caminho em situa??es de contravento foi modelado, implementado e testado em simula??o. Para gerar os pontos do caminho, o m?todo utiliza dois par?metros: a dist?ncia dispon?vel e a orienta??o desejada para o veleiro durante a manobra. Em seguida, um m?todo de otimiza??o foi implementado e testado em simula??o. O m?todo utiliza algoritmos gen?ticos para manipular os par?metros do m?todo de gera??o de caminhos, encontrando quais par?metros geram o trajeto de menor tempo ao destino. O trabalho apresenta diversos testes em simula??o para demonstrar a validade e robustez dos m?todos desenvolvidos. The main challenges in the development of autonomous sailboats are: control, path and trajectory planning, sensor data acquitision, and power supply. Towards this direction, this paper introduces a study on the problems of control and path planning commonly found during the autonomous sailing projects. The methods developed here are to be applied in the sailboats used in the N-Boat project, allowing them to reach targets points accurately and quickly, and to perform one of the must difficult tasks in sailing that is navigating against the wind. To achieve these goals, at first, a method to find the most appropriate low level controller for the desired application is developed. This method uses a dynamic PI controller, coming up with a table that contains the best proportional and integrative parameters that are appropriate to each situation according to the model used. A method for generation of paths in situations contrary to wind is also modeled, implemented and tested (in simulation). To generate the way points, this method takes into account two parameters: the distance available for the maneuvering and the desired orientation of the boat during the maneuver. An optimization method is proposed, based on genethic algorithm, implemented, and also tested (in simulation) for getting the controller best parameters. The method manipulate some defined parameters for generating paths, finding the ones that generate the path in which the boat achieves the minimum time to destination. Results of various simulation experiments are shown to demonstrate the validity and robustness of the methods developed. 2017-03-15T22:17:57Z 2017-03-15T22:17:57Z 2016-07-13 info:eu-repo/semantics/publishedVersion info:eu-repo/semantics/masterThesis SANTOS, Davi Henrique dos. Controle de orienta??o e planejamento de caminho de curta dist?ncia para o veleiro rob?tico NBoat II. 2016. 90f. Disserta??o (Mestrado em Engenharia El?trica e de Computa??o) - Centro de Tecnologia, Universidade Federal do Rio Grande do Norte, Natal, 2016. https://repositorio.ufrn.br/jspui/handle/123456789/22257 por info:eu-repo/semantics/openAccess PROGRAMA DE P?S-GRADUA??O EM ENGENHARIA EL?TRICA E DE COMPUTA??O UFRN Brasil reponame:Repositório Institucional da UFRN instname:Universidade Federal do Rio Grande do Norte instacron:UFRN